Valtteri Bottas: “It’s always a good feeling to split the Ferraris”
Valtteri Bottas felt he got the most out of his qualifying session for the Spanish Grand Prix at the Circuit de Catalunya with fourth place, but Williams Martini Racing team-mate Felipe Massa was disappointed with his ninth place on the grid after making a mistake on his quick lap. Bottas was happy to qualify fourth, and be ahead of the Ferrari of Kimi Raikkonen, and hopes to be able to keep him behind him on Sunday.
